Nitration of Tyrosyl Residues in {kappa}- and {alpha}sl-Caseins

J. H. Woychik and M. V. Wondolowski

Eastern Utilization Research and Development Division, USDA, Philadelphia, Pennsylvania 19118

ABSTRACT

Tyrosyl residues in {kappa}- and {alpha}s1-casein were nitrated with tetranitromethane and its effect on their properties determined.

Nitration of up to four of the eight tyrosines in {kappa}-casein did not affect its {alpha}s1-casein-stabilizing ability; additional nitration progressively decreased the stabilizing ability and this was totally absent after all eight tyrosyl residues were nitrated.

Nitrated {alpha}s1-casein retained its calcium sensitivity but was unable to form a protective complex with {kappa}-casein after nitration of four of its 12 tyrosyl residues. A complete tyrosyl nitration of {kappa}- and {alpha}s1-caseins and of a 1:10 {kappa}-/{alpha}s1-complex was achieved at low molar ratios of tetranitromethane. This suggests that these proteins are devoid of major secondary or tertiary structures.
